Gamebrain Signs New Round of Game Development Partners


Today Gamebrain announced a series of new strategic partnerships to further build out its game development workflow platform, including AppThwack, Bugsnag, and Babel Media. The new round of deals follows Gamebrain’s initial signing of Kontagent, solidifying additional facets of game development support needed by small to mid-sized developers to succeed. Gamebrain’s workflow solution aims to offer the best game development tools in the industry on an affordable level, combining a central knowledge bank of resources and tools with manageable processes and milestones to keep projects on track.

AppThwack is a Portland, Oregon-based company offering automated mobile device testing tools and services for Android, iOS and mobile web developers, particularly in areas involving complex interactions between distributed devices.

Babel Media is the leading global provider of outsourced specialist services to the games and interactive entertainment industries, offering customers a complete outsourced testing and localization service for all Console, PC, Online, Handheld and Mobile content. The company was voted Best Outsourcing Company 2003, 2005, 2007 and 2008 at the Develop Industry Excellence Awards.

Bugsnag’s real-time error-reporting platform helps developers cut costs and save time by catching errors as they happen. Bugsnag’s comprehensive yet flexible web, mobile, and desktop support (OS X), lets developers easily track and navigate exceptions from multiple projects all under a single dashboard.
